Ottimizza le Performance con SARSA: Guida Completa

Scopri come SARSA può rivoluzionare le performance dei tuoi modelli predittivi e portare l’Intelligenza Artificiale ad un nuovo livello di efficacia e adattabilità.

Ottimizza le Performance Utilizzando SARSA nell’Intelligenza Artificiale

L’uso di algoritmi di apprendimento automatico, in particolare nell’ambito della Reinforcement Learning, ha dimostrato notevoli progressi nel migliorare le performance di sistemi intelligenti. In questo contesto, SARSA (State-Action-Reward-State-Action) è un algoritmo chiave che può essere impiegato per ottimizzare le prestazioni dei modelli predittivi. Questo articolo esplora come utilizzare SARSA per incrementare le performance e ottenere risultati ottimali.

Introduzione a SARSA

SARSA è un algoritmo di apprendimento per rinforzo che si basa su una politica di miglioramento graduale dei valori Q, tenendo conto dell’azione corrente e della successiva azione scelta. Questo approccio permette di gestire efficacemente il trade-off esplorazione-sfruttamento, essenziale nel processo di apprendimento automatizzato. Utilizzando SARSA, è possibile massimizzare il reward ottenuto in un ambiente di apprendimento.

Vantaggi di SARSA:

  • Gestione efficiente dell’esplorazione dell’ambiente
  • Adattamento continuo della policy per massimizzare il reward
  • Maggiore stabilità rispetto ad altri algoritmi di apprendimento per rinforzo

Applicazioni di SARSA per Migliorare le Performance

L’impiego di SARSA può portare a miglioramenti significativi in diversi contesti. Vediamo alcune applicazioni pratiche per utilizzare SARSA e ottimizzare le performance:

Applicazione Descrizione
Giochi SARSA può essere utilizzato per addestrare agenti di intelligenza artificiale a giocare a giochi, come ad esempio Cartpole o Atari.
Robotica Nell’ambito della robotica, SARSA può essere impiegato per ottimizzare il comportamento di robot in compiti specifici, come la navigazione autonoma.
Sistemi di Consulenza SARSA può essere applicato per creare sistemi di consulenza personalizzata, adattando la raccomandazione in base alle interazioni dell’utente.

Implementazione Pratica di SARSA

Per utilizzare SARSA con successo e migliorare le performance dei tuoi modelli predittivi, è fondamentale seguire una serie di passaggi chiave:

  1. Definizione dell’Ambiente di Apprendimento: Identifica chiaramente l’ambiente in cui il tuo agente dovrà apprendere e agire.
  2. Definizione delle Azioni e delle Politiche: Stabilisci le azioni che l’agente può compiere e le politiche da seguire per ottenere il massimo reward.
  3. Implementazione dell’Algoritmo SARSA: Codifica l’algoritmo SARSA nel tuo ambiente di sviluppo preferito, assicurandoti di considerare gli aggiornamenti dei valori Q in base alle azioni compiute.
  4. Addestramento e Ottimizzazione: Avvia il processo di addestramento del modello utilizzando SARSA e ottimizza i parametri per massimizzare le performance.

Considerazioni Finali

Utilizzare SARSA per migliorare le performance dei modelli di intelligenza artificiale è un passo fondamentale per ottenere risultati superiori e adattabili. Grazie alla sua capacità di gestire l’esplorazione dell’ambiente e l’adattamento continuo della policy, SARSA si rivela essere uno strumento potente per ottimizzare il comportamento dei tuoi agenti intelligenti. Investire tempo ed energia nell’implementazione di SARSA può portare a vantaggi significativi e risultati di alto livello.

In conclusione, l’utilizzo di SARSA rappresenta un’opportunità unica per elevare le prestazioni dei tuoi sistemi intelligenti e raggiungere nuovi traguardi nel campo dell’intelligenza artificiale. Sfrutta appieno il potenziale di SARSA e preparati a sperimentare miglioramenti tangibili che porteranno il tuo lavoro ad un livello superiore.

Translate »